Advanced Certificate in ESG Investing for Human Rights
-- ViewingNowThe Advanced Certificate in ESG Investing for Human Rights is a comprehensive course that addresses the growing importance of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) factors in investment decisions, with a particular focus on human rights. This program is crucial for professionals seeking to align their investment strategies with ethical, sustainable, and human rights principles.

CourseDetails
โข Advanced ESG Integration in Investment Analysis: Understanding and applying 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) factors in investment analysis and decision-making processes.
โข Human Rights & ESG Investing: Examining the relationship between ESG investing and human rights, including the role of investors in promoting and protecting human rights.
โข International Human Rights Framework: Delving into global human rights standards, treaties, and mechanisms, and their relevance to ESG investing.
โข Case Studies in Human Rights Investing: Exploring real-world examples of ESG investing focused on human rights, highlighting successes, challenges, and lessons learned.
โข ESG Metrics & Data for Human Rights Assessment: Mastering the use of ESG metrics and data to evaluate and monitor human rights performance in investment portfolios.
โข Investor Engagement & Advocacy on Human Rights: Developing strategies for investor engagement and advocacy on human rights issues, including shareholder resolutions, dialogues, and collaborations.
โข Legal & Regulatory Context for Human Rights Investing: Reviewing the legal and regulatory landscape for ESG investing, particularly in relation to human rights, including emerging trends and best practices.
โข Responsible Investment in High-Risk Sectors: Navigating the complexities of ESG investing in sectors with high human rights risks, such as extractives, apparel, and technology.
โข Portfolio Construction & Management for Human Rights Investing: Designing and managing investment portfolios with a focus on human rights, considering factors such as diversification, risk management, and return potential.
โข Impact Assessment & Reporting for Human Rights Investing: Measuring and reporting the social and environmental impact of ESG investments, including the promotion and protection of human rights.
